The Browns of Cleveland have a blatant and obvious need for this offseason, and it is in the quarter-rear.
With the overall choice n ° 2, they could potentially remedy this situation or could devote the defensive line with an elite rusher.

But apart from the post at the center, which other postal groups, could the director general, Andrew Berry, target in the draft of NFL next month?
The list is long and distinguished.
And the writer of Clevelandbrowns.com, Kelsey Russo, tried to respond recently to that.
She noted that the team had made some improvements in the initial phase of the free agency with the additions of the secondary Jerome Baker, the defensive striker Maliek Collins, the goalkeeper Teven Jenkins, the striker Cornelius Lucas and the defensive winger Joe Tryon-Shoyinka, as well as the re-insignificant corner Tony Brown and the second Devin Bush.
Russo said the greatest need offensively was to run back and a tight -end depth.

“The room consists of Jerome Ford and Pierre Strong Jr., because Nick Chubb has become a free agent without restriction when the new league year started”, ” Russo said. “They need another option in this room to help in depth. The tight end is in a similar position, David Njoku leading this room.
“Browns have undergone exclusive exclusive rights Blake Whiteheart and Brenden Bates on the list after having signed it towards the end of 2024, but they could use another sensor and pass block.”
In defense, security could use aid.
“A piece which consists in simply granting Delpit, Ronnie Hickman and Christopher Edmonds”, ” Russo continued. “After the retreat of Rodney McLeod Jr., the Browns not only lost a veteran presence in the secondary, but they also lost depth.

“Whether this addition comes in a free agent or a recruit, secondary could use another security to strengthen the unit.”
